問題描述
在公司做的app地圖頁面,出現某些地方點擊後沒有反應。
分析過程
一開始感覺很奇怪,沒一點頭緒。
後來突然想着用UI Automator Viewer看下頁面佈局(也可以打開手機開發者選項中的“顯示佈局邊界”),結果發現了端倪,有個佈局有一部分超出來了,而且是透明的。導致雖然你看不到,但是實際上他遮擋了地圖控件,導致點擊無效。
附錄
UI Automator Viewer是AndroidStudio自帶的工具,位於“Android\Sdk\tools\bin\uiautomatorviewer.bat”